Playing with Stars: Rotraut at Desert Botanical Garden
Oct. 7, 2022 - May 14, 2023
The bold and lyrical large-scale sculptures of Rotraut will enliven the Garden trails while a selection of her paintings and small sculpture fill the Ottosen Gallery. Known around the world, and based in Arizona, Rotraut’s artwork explores the energy of the seasons and the relationship of nature with the sky, sun and universe.
Museum of the Moon at Desert Botanical Garden
Feb. 7 – 14
Prepare to be moonstruck at the Garden for a limited time only. Museum of the Moon by UK artist Luke Jerram inspires awe with a 23-foot diameter glowing moon that provides detailed views of the lunar surface fused with a stellar soundtrack by composer Dan Jones.
